Tony pulled in to the beltway burger parking lot with a grin on his
face. "Hey! How'd you know I like this place" Abby asked. "Well, you didn't
seem like to high snooty tootie type. So I figured comfort and quickness
and vola!" Tony gave her a smirk
"And the fact that all those high class joints stop serving before 10pm had
nothing to do with it?" Abby teased back. "Ah, well there's that too." Tony
replied.
They entered and each ordered there own by number. Tony noticed the cashier giving them a bit of an odd look. "He thinks I'm cheap for not buying your dinner." Tony whispered as they waited for their food. "Hey! You think this guy's a cheapskate for not buying me my meal?" Abby asked sweetly as the cashier returned with the food. "No, no I was just looking at your tattoo and was wondering if that spider crawled somewhere else on your body." Flirted the guy. "Ah, hello I'm standing right here." Tony said as he waved his hands in front of the guy. "Sorry, you'll have to forgive my friend. He's just a little jealous." Abby winked back at Tony.
"Sheesh, Abby that guy thinks I'm a total prick now." Tony whined "Oh give it up Tony. You got to stop worrying about what others think of you." Abby said with a flourish. Tony just mumbled something and ate his burger. "What was that?" Abby teased. Tony finished swallowing the bite of burger and answered "I said you're used to it. I mean you are different and that's one of the things I love about you. But me, I'm just the normal Joe. I played basketball and watch the NFL. I don't usually have to deal with being unique. I try not to stand out, so when I do it's hard for me to deal with."
Abby just sat there for a moment before saying "OK, I guess I get where you're coming from. But still, just relax you're with me tonight." Tony gave her a smile and went on eating his burger. "So, what other thing do you love about me?" Abby said with a grin. Tony didn't even look up as he threw a fry at her. "Oh, that's how it's going to be?" Abby replied and grabbed an ice cube out of her glass and stuck it down Tony's shirt. Tony jumped up so fast that hit bumped his head on the light dangling in the middle of the table. The little dance he did trying to get that ice cube made Abby double over with laughter. As the ice cube fell to the floor Tony gave her in evil grin and flicked some of his ice water at her. The cold wetness startled her and she looked back a Tony "Ok, Ok truce." Abby smiled at him. She was rewarded with one of his drop dead gorgeous smiles "Deal" Tony replied.
